Objective: To study the phytochemistry, anti-asthmatic and antioxidant activities of the aqueous leaf extract of Anchomanes difformis (Blume) Engl. (A. difformis) and to verify claims of use in folk medicine. Methods: For anti-asthmatic activity, male and female guinea pigs with average body weight of (451.4 +/- 118.1) g were divided into six groups of six animals each. Group 1 served as control (distilled water); Group 2 was administered with salbutamol (reference drug) only; Group 3 served as ovalbumin sensitized group, Group 4, 5 and 6 were treated with A. difformis extract at doses of 100, 200 and 400 mg/kg, respectively. Described methods were used to test fluid viscosity, fluid volume and quantitative phytochemistry analysis. Absorbance was read using a UV-Vis spectrophotometer and results computed in percentage. Total antioxidant assays [2, 2-diphenyl-1-picrylhydrazyl (DPPH) and lipid peroxidation assay], were carried out using reported procedures. Results: The anti-asthmatic evaluation showed that protection from asthma of the animals in Group 6 (400 mg/kg, 32.7%) were similar to that in Group 2 (salbutamol, 33.0%). Excised trachea was free of mucus secretion in Group 5 (200 mg/kg) as was observed in the control group. Fluid volume increase in Groups 3 and 6 indicated mucus secretion. DPPH radical scavenging activity of extract was effective as ascorbic acid which served as standard at 20 mu g/mL. But, the extract elicited low lipid peroxidation activity compared with the reference (tocopherol) at concentrations tested. Conclusions: A. difformis aqueous leaf extract is safe and possesses positive antiasthmatic and antioxidant activities as claimed by traditional herbal practitioners in Delta State.
